What are the responsibilities and job description for the Lead Marine Technician position at Crawford Thomas Recruiting?
Our client is a full-service marina offering wet slips, moorings, dry storage, boat services and year-round maintenance just minutes from Long Island Sound. It’s known for its peaceful waters, boating and fishing access, environmental stewardship as a Certified Clean Marina, and additional offerings like valet service and on-site marine parts and service.
Salary: $32 – $40 per hour (based on experience)
Job Summary
Our client is seeking a Lead Marine Technician to inspect, maintain, and repair a variety of boats while leading a team of marine technicians. You will ensure optimal performance of engines, hulls, rigging, sails, and onboard systems. This role requires expertise in marine mechanical, electrical, and plumbing systems, strong problem-solving skills, and a commitment to providing exceptional service to marina members.
Job Responsibilities: Lead and mentor a team of marine technicians, assigning tasks and ensuring work is completed efficiently and safely. Conduct inspections, maintenance, and repairs on all types of boats. Utilize diagnostic equipment to troubleshoot and repair marine systems. Install and test sanitation, refrigeration, electrical, steering, and accessory systems. Replace, remove, and install vessel components as needed. Assess job requirements, including budgeted time and completion deadlines. Assign parts and purchases to the appropriate vessels/tickets. Maintain and utilize own tools effectively. Be available for overtime to meet deadlines. Adhere to safety protocols and report all incidents immediately. Perform additional duties as assigned by management.
Qualifications: High school diploma or equivalent; technical school training preferred. 2–5 years of marine technician experience preferred. ABYC and/or manufacturer certifications preferred. Experience with both gas and diesel engines preferred. Ability to lift 50 pounds, work in confined spaces, and ascend/descend ladders. Basic boat handling skills preferred. Strong leadership, teamwork, communication, and problem-solving skills. Eagerness to contribute in a fast-paced, service-oriented environment. ,
